Error en Código de Autenticación Visual Basic [SOLUCIONADO]

Uno de los desafíos más comunes que enfrentan los programadores al trabajar con Visual Basic es el error en el código de autenticación. Esta problemática puede detener un proyecto en seco hasta que se descubra la raíz del asunto. En este artículo, te ayudaremos a profundizar en este problema de autenticación y te proporcionaremos soluciones probadas para ayudarte a superar este obstáculo.

Para aquellos nuevos en este tema, Visual Basic, también conocido como VB, es un lenguaje de programación orientado a eventos de Microsoft. Muchas veces, los problemas de autenticación surgen al intentar conectar tus aplicaciones VB a las bases de datos u otros recursos protegidos. Esto puede incluir la interacción con sistemas operativos, redes y otras aplicaciones.

  Private Function TryAuthenticate() As Boolean
      Dim authenticated As Boolean = False

      ' codigo de autentificacion
      '...

      Return authenticated
  End Function

En este ejemplo simple de autenticación, la función TryAuthenticate devuelve un valor booleano para indicar si la autenticación fue exitosa o no. Dependiendo de cómo se traten los errores de autenticación, es posible que se reciba un error en el código de autenticación de Visual Basic al intentar ejecutar esta función.

Ahora bien, este problema de autenticación en Visual Basic puede materializarse de varias maneras. Algunos programadores podrían encontrarse con una excepción de tipo ‘UnauthorizedAccessException’, mientras que otros podrían enfrentarse a fallos como ‘SqlException: Error de inicio de sesión para el usuario’. Sea cual sea tu caso, no desesperes, pues existen varias estrategias que puedes implementar para superarlo.

  Try
      'codigo de autentificacion
  Catch ex As Exception
      MessageBox.Show("Error: " & ex.Message, "Error de autenticacion")
  End Try

En esta porción de código estamos implementando un bloque Try-Catch para manejar los errores. Si ocurre un error durante el segmento de código del bloque Try, el control del programa se pasa al bloque Catch correspondiente, lo que ayuda a prevenir los cuelgues de las aplicaciones.

Más allá de estas soluciones de codificación, también vale la pena considerar aspectos más amplios del manejo de la autenticación. Por ejemplo, el diseño de tus sistemas de seguridad es crucial. Podrías optar por usar una base de datos para almacenar contraseñas y otros datos de autenticación, o podrías optar por soluciones basadas en claves API o tokens JWT.

Además, es fundamental mantenerse actualizado con las mejores prácticas de codificación y seguridad. Las técnicas obsoletas podrían abrir la puerta a errores en el código de autenticación en Visual Basic y otros problemas relacionados. Mantén tus habilidades afiladas y no olvides probar y revisar tus códigos regularmente.

Al final del día, la programación y la codificación se tratan de resolver problemas. Es probable que te encuentres con el error de código de autenticación en Visual Basic u otros desafíos similares de vez en cuando. Sin embargo, con las estrategias adecuadas y una mentalidad de resolución de problemas, deberías ser capaz de superar cualquier obstáculo que se presente en tu camino.

Esta web utiliza cookies propias y de terceros para su correcto funcionamiento y para fines analíticos y para mostrarte publicidad relacionada con sus preferencias en base a un perfil elaborado a partir de tus hábitos de navegación. Al hacer clic en el botón Aceptar, acepta el uso de estas tecnologías y el procesamiento de tus datos para estos propósitos. Más información
Privacidad